Water hardness is caused by naturally occurring minerals, mainly calcium and magnesium. It is measured in parts per million of calcium carbonate.

It is the standard way of expressing hardness as milligrams per litre of calcium carbonate, usually shown as ppm.
Your supplier depends on your postcode and water supply zone. The checker displays the best available company data.
Neighbouring postcodes can draw water from different supply zones, reservoirs, or boreholes, so hardness can vary locally.
A softener removes hardness minerals. A limescale filter or whole house system can inhibit scale and improve water quality with less maintenance.
